Alienware’s Steam Machine Coming in September 2014

It’s been confirmed by Dell Representatives that the Alienware Steam Machine will be released sometime in September 2014. Though its specs are still unknown, it has been said that it will be competitively priced to the Xbox One at around $499.

Valve’s Gabe Newell introduced the Steam Machine at CES 2014 in Las Vegas, NV last week, showing off their plans for their Steam OS.

Alienware’s Steam Machine is designed as a compact console, measuring at 8″ x 8″,  and is 3″ tall, which is quite a bit smaller than the Playstation 4 and Xbox One. It’s designed to scale native at 1080p, and even higher if desired. It’ll feature an external power supply, offer 2 USB 3.0 ports, optical audio connector, ethernet jack and HDMI input and output. Yet there are still no plans as to when they’ll offer live television feeds.

Alienware has stated that the Steam Machine will be the most affordable machine they’ve ever produced.
